IL-1B can serve as a healing process and is a critical regulator of diabetic foot ulcer

Abstract: Background: Diabetic foot ulcer (DFU) is the main cause of disability in diabetic patients. However, the molecular changes underlying the occurrence and progression of DFU remain unclear. We conducted this study to examine gene alterations in different DFU patients.Methods: GSE143735 and GSE134431 transcriptome data sets were acquired from the Gene Expression Omnibus database, and differential expression analyses of the genes in these data sets were performed.A functional enrichment analysis of the differentia… Show more

“…In addition to paying attention to the treatment of systemic factors, such as the control of blood sugar, blood pressure, blood lipid, anti-infection and the improvement of microcirculation, we must also pay attention to the standardized treatment of chronic wound itself. Only the comprehensive coordinated treatment of whole body and local can promote the healing of chronic difficult wound ( 22 , 23 ). DFU healing is a multi-step process that requires the coordination of 4 distinct but overlapping physiologically logical phases, including hemostasis, inflammation, proliferation, and remodeling ( 24 ).…”
